Dakota Kirchenschlager gets on a four-year-old Hickory Holly Time gelding owned by Turner Performance Horses, a horse he has high expectations for heading into the futurities. This colt has a lot of go and stays up, which Dakota likes, but that energy has to be channeled correctly from the start.
If the steer doesn't give him the right look or the opportunity to put his horse in the correct position, Dakota won't force it. He'll slow things down, have his header circle the cow, and reposition until the setup is right. Protecting a young horse from developing bad habits early is worth every extra second it takes to get the approach correct.
Dakota also addresses how his horse handles the jerk. If the horse doesn't take it well, he won't move on. He'll have him hold, relax, and collect himself in the exact position he wants him in before asking again. Building the right response to pressure now pays dividends later. As always, Dakota ends the session on a good note, with the horse still wanting more. On young futurity prospects especially, that mindset is everything.
